What snow guards actually do
A snow guard is not a decorative accessory. It is a structural traffic police officer. On a steep roofing, gravity acts upon the complete mass of accumulated snow. Meltwater lubes the user interface with metal or slate and whole slabs can let go. Snow guards increase friction, break up the piece, and keep activity incremental as opposed to tragic. On lengthy eaves, continuous rails limit large tributary areas, while individual pad-style guards develop plenty of factors that stitch snow to the roofing system surface.
Choice of system is dictated by roofing system kind and expected lots. On a standing joint metal roofing in the Tetons, we could run 3 rows of copper rails with mechanically connected clamps, supplemented by point guards over access. On a slate roofing system in Vermont, a thick field of soldered copper pads can manage both glue and mechanical restraint while shielding the slate from take advantage of damages. The roof is a system. Snow guards are just exactly how you tell that system to handle momentum.
Alpine loads in genuine numbers
It aids to place numbers to the issue. Think about a 10:12 standing joint roofing in a hill valley that sees 60 to 90 inches of seasonal snowfall. Snow thickness on a chilly roof differs, yet 20 to 30 extra pounds per cubic foot is common. A 2 foot snowpack at 25 pcf yields regarding 50 psf on the horizontal, which equates to a lot more on the real slope. That lots is not fixed either. When temperatures swing and meltwater forms a lubricating layer, the moving mass can put in vibrant pressures several times greater at suspensions like valleys and eaves.
Engineering submittals from credible manufacturers make up this with tributary area estimations, fastener pull-out values in the actual deck, and clamp slip resistance measured on the real seam account. In method, we add safety variables birthed from experience. At one backcountry lodge in Colorado, a 52 foot eave faced the prevailing wind and caught spindrift that set right into a dense cornice. We included an added rail, connected into structural blocking at the eave, and presented pad-style guards in a staggered field above the primary web traffic areas. That arrangement has actually seen nine winters months and no failures, while a bordering structure with repainted light weight aluminum guards restored its gutter line twice.
Coastal rust is a various animal
Salt spray rewords the policies. The chloride ions that ride on ocean air strike protective oxides on lots of steels and open matching that comes to be a deterioration beachhead. On steel roofings near the Atlantic, I have actually pulled off guards after just five years that looked penalty from the road however had fasteners consumed slim under the washer. Stainless steel supplies a bush, but alloy choice issues. Kind 316 outlives 304 in marine atmospheres, and even after that, dissimilar contact with aluminum panels or zinc-coated bolts can produce a galvanic pile that corrodes the least noble component first.
Copper turns that script. The preliminary oxide skin strengthens to the acquainted brown and then a turquoise patina in salt air over a period that varies from a few years to a couple of decades, depending upon exposure. That aging is not a cosmetic accident. It is a chemically secure barrier that hinders additional corrosion. On a shingle-style house on a granite bluff in Maine, we mounted copper rails and pad guards twenty years earlier. The patina now is a soft seafoam that belongs to the website. The hardware under the guards coincides metal, the very same possibility, and equally as silent. There has actually been no galvanic surprise, no ring of rust around the base plates, no guesswork.
Material realities that matter at elevation and at sea level
Copper is not magic, it is predictable. The predictability is what makes it exceptional.
Thermal growth should be managed. Copper expands concerning 9.4 microstrains per level Fahrenheit. On a 16 foot rail seeing a 100 level swing, that is about 0.18 inches of movement you have to accommodate. Excellent rail layouts use slotted holes and floating splice couplers. Great installers leave development voids and keep the rail lined up to lower tension risers. On pad-style guards, the copper shank and base plate share the exact same expansion actions as the roof frying pan or flashing, which maintains the bond from working against itself.
Work solidifying is a genuine phenomenon. Copper tenses with chilly working. That serves in developing personalized profiles that require crisp lines, however over functioning a bend can develop a breakable joint. When we produce Custom-made Snow Guards at the store degree, we control brake stress and sequence so the grain of the copper supports the geometry. The most effective guards are conservative fit, stout at the base, and never ever ask a slim tab to do a thick job.
Soldered joints require surface area preparation and the right flux. Improperly cleansed copper or an aggressive change left in position will certainly undermine an otherwise best style. We use neutralized fluxes for roof covering job, wash thoroughly, and follow with a patina-friendly wash. The bond, as soon as made, is a metallurgical link that outlives adhesives and many mechanical arrangements, offered the substrate is just as sound.
Fasteners and clamps ought to match the system. A copper guard on a steel screw is a debate waiting to happen in coastal air. On standing joint, non-penetrating copper or stainless clamps stop leaks and preserve panel guarantees. In slate or ceramic tile, copper nails or stainless bolts developed for the purpose are the only sensible options.

Details that divide a lifetime system from a ten-year patch
Most snow-guard failings map back to one of 3 issues: undervaluing load paths, blending steels incorrectly, and sloppy installation in the shoulder periods when everyone is competing the weather.
Load courses are three dimensional. A rail might hold, however the screws back into a gapped sheathing layer will certainly crush the fibers under cyclical lots and loosen up over years. We chase structure. In brand-new work we ask for blocking at the eave and along intended rail lines. In retrofits, we locate studs or rafters with a rare-earth magnet and a cam, after that shift layout to tie right into real timber. On stonework chimneys obtaining adjacent roofing system lots, we coordinate with the team delivering Personalized Dormers or custom-made cupolas so penetration factors are less and backing plates are constructed in.
Metal blending is commonly innocent. A person runs a copper leader head to a stainless scupper. Or a painted steel panel fulfills a copper guard with a stainless screw and a plated washer. In coastal air, the most anodic steel sacrifices itself. The solution is basic: keep like with like when possible, protect dissimilar contacts with thin neoprene or a suitable sealant where they can not be prevented, and specify bolts that match the most noble metal in the stack.
Installation pace issues. Soldering in a flurry of snows is asking water to ride the heat right into the joint. Adhesive set times double near cold and treatment insufficient if temperature levels dive over night. The response is not blowing, it is organizing. We organize winter installs for the midday home window, camping tent crucial joints with a canvas windbreak, and use heating units that take the edge off without baking oils into the copper.

A short spec list that protects against lengthy headaches
- Confirm structural backing at rail lines and eaves. If nonexistent, include obstructing throughout mounting or through-sheathing supports designed for roof work.
- Keep metals compatible. Usage copper guards with copper or stainless fasteners as suitable, protect dissimilar contacts, and prevent plated equipment in seaside air.
- Match add-on to roofing type. Secure to standing joints without penetrations, solder or mechanically fasten to copper frying pans on slate and ceramic tile, and regard maker guarantee constraints.
- Calculate tributary locations with genuine snow thickness and slopes. Include security variables at valleys, dormer cheeks, and leeward drifts.
- Allow for thermal movement. Specify slotted openings, floating splices, and development voids for lengthy rails.

When copper is not the ideal answer
There are projects where budget plan, burglary risk, or layout intent point somewhere else. On low-snow inland stockrooms where proprietors like an uniform repainted surface area and change roofing systems on a twenty years cycle, stainless or light weight aluminum rails can be suitable. On institutions in locations with high salvage theft, visible copper could be an obligation, and we work with covered stainless that reads quieter. On traditionally repainted metal roofing systems, copper can review as out of place unless it is resembled in various other details.
What never ever transforms is the need to appreciate the physics. Even the very best material will certainly fail if severely put, under sustained, or compelled to bargain a low-grade roof.
